Transaction 41e7592722f31c0e7314beb42aa71a19b41661764011ad63effad63aee6066ba

3 Input
2 Outputs
  • 41e7592722f31c0e7314beb42aa71a19b41661764011ad63effad63aee6066ba:0
  • value  35051
    address  14tMFtBQdCRN8Cf1LfgBbPBgrUb4Ky23aB
  • 41e7592722f31c0e7314beb42aa71a19b41661764011ad63effad63aee6066ba:1
  • value  470000
    address  33HDguVGYN8pAdG6QWeCbMZ9nbHpZMoZoV